About This Collectible: This is a dokra crafted hanging brass bell. Dokra or Dhokra is an ancient Indian brass art and craft which has been living through over 4000 years. This art form was started back in the period of one of the oldest societies, Mohenjo- daro. The simplicity of this primitive Indian craft has always attracted people. Dokra is principally a non-ferrous ornon-iron grounded casting of essence using lost- wax casting.
